Following their Süper Lig triumph, Galatasaray's management has scheduled an urgent meeting to organize the upcoming championship celebrations. This gathering aims to iron out the specifics for the festivities slated to take place at RAMS Park, accelerating the planning process for post-championship events.
Championship Secured
Galatasaray secured the Trendyol Süper Lig title in Week 33, defeating Antalyaspor 4-2. This victory clinched the championship with a week remaining in the season. The club has now achieved its fourth consecutive league title, marking its twenty-sixth overall.
Goals from Victor Osimhen (twice), Mario Lemina, and Kaan Ayhan sealed the win, prompting the board's decision to convene. The upcoming meeting is expected to address crucial aspects such as security and logistics for the celebratory events.
Logistical Planning Underway
The primary focus of the board meeting will be to ensure a smooth and safe celebration for fans. Discussions will encompass crowd management, venue setup, and coordination with local authorities. This proactive approach aims to manage the significant public interest surrounding the club's latest achievement.
While the exact date for the RAMS Park celebration is yet to be announced, the board's swift action indicates a desire to capitalize on the team's success. The planning will also consider potential impacts on local traffic and public services, ensuring minimal disruption.
